hw/arm/boot: Rename elf_{low, high}_addr to image_{low, high}_addr



Rename the elf_low_addr and elf_high_addr variables to image_low_addr
and image_high_addr -- in the next commit we will extend them to
be set for other kinds of image file and not just ELF files.
